I am a cardiologist and physician-scientist with board certifications in general cardiology and echocardiography. My clinical interest is in inpatient cardiology where I continue to practice.

Since 2020, my primary appointment has been with Amgen where I focus on leveraging human genetics and basic scientific insights to create clinically meaningful advances in cardiovascular medicine. My research focuses on understanding human cardiovascular disease by studying the genetics and gene regulation underlying these disorders, utilizing technologies such as in vivo genetic and enhancer screens coupled with computational biology.
